Top New Hampshire Schools in Allied Health Professions

Our analysis found Franklin Pierce University to be the best school for allied health professions students who want to pursue a degree in New Hampshire. Franklin Pierce is a small private not-for-profit school located in the rural area of Rindge.

Out of the 2 schools in New Hampshire that were part of this year’s ranking, Plymouth State University landed the # 2 spot on the list. Plymouth State is a small public school located in the town of Plymouth.
